I am wondering what schools or methods do most people/landscapers use to landscape their yards. Landscapes seem to be as equally challenging as a house if not more difficult in Fen Shui. Once a tree is planted, it can last for hundreds of years, whereas a wall color can be repainted after some years and furniture can easily be rearranged.
Do you use Bagua method, based on fixed original 5-element associations with the directions: north=water, northeast=earth, east=wood, and etc? Or do you use flying star and treat the house and its landscape as a WHOLE?
